Jill G Hall

Recipe for Forgiveness

Peel back fury
from bitter
betrayal,
broken heart.
Hurl and grind waste
into garbage disposal.

Boil remainder
in medium pot.
Rinse residual
regret in colander.
Bury in backyard.

In saucepan simmer
what’s left, add
soy sauce, splash
of cinnamon kiss,
kick of cayenne
pepper, sprinkle
pinch of sugar
over top.

Stir for months
or even years
until sweet
compassion
and goodness
is all that’s left.

Serve and move on
to begin a deeper life.
